The Market Place is a restaurant in Asheville, North Carolina. [1] It was a semifinalist in the Outstanding Restaurant category of the James Beard Foundation Awards in 2024. [2] It is owned by chef William Dissen. [3]

Neng Jr.'s is a Filipino restaurant in Asheville, North Carolina. [1] [2] [3] Established in June 2022, the business was included in The New York Times 's 2023 list of the 50 best restaurants in the United States. [4]
